How Much Does a Metal Roof Cost in Canton, OH?

The average metal roof cost in Canton, OH ranges between $8,500 and $21,000, depending on the size of the roof, the type of metal, labor, and additional features like insulation or coatings.

On a per square foot basis, expect to pay between $5.50 and $12.00, with the national average hovering around $10 per square foot.

To give you a better idea:

  • 1,500 sq. ft. roof: $8,250 – $18,000

  • 2,000 sq. ft. roof: $11,000 – $24,000

  • 2,500 sq. ft. roof: $13,750 – $30,000

This cost is higher than asphalt shingles, but metal roofing lasts significantly longer and offers additional benefits that offset the upfront investment.

Factors That Affect Metal Roof Pricing

1. Type of Metal Roofing

Not all metal roofs are the same. The type of material you choose will directly impact your total cost:

  • Steel (Galvanized or Galvalume): Most common, durable, and affordable ($6–$10 per sq. ft.)

  • Aluminum: Lightweight and rust-resistant, especially good near moisture-heavy areas ($7–$12 per sq. ft.)

  • Copper: Premium material known for beauty and longevity, but can exceed $20 per sq. ft.

  • Zinc: Long-lasting and corrosion-resistant, typically $12–$15 per sq. ft.

The metal itself also varies in thickness (referred to as gauge), and thicker panels typically cost more but offer improved durability.

2. Panel Style

Metal roofs come in several panel styles, and each has a different installation cost:

  • Standing Seam: Clean, modern appearance with concealed fasteners; costs more due to specialized labor

  • Corrugated Panels: Ribbed and exposed-fastener systems; more affordable and quicker to install

  • Metal Shingles or Tiles: Mimic traditional shingles or slate; cost-effective and visually appealing

3. Roof Complexity

Simple, gable-style roofs are more affordable than complex designs with multiple valleys, dormers, skylights, and steep slopes. Roofing labor becomes more intensive with these features, increasing overall cost.

4. Labor and Installation

Labor in Canton, OH, is more affordable than in larger metro areas, but quality still matters. Installing a metal roof takes expertise and precision. At Silver Leaf, we employ experienced installers trained in all metal roofing systems to ensure your new roof performs as expected for decades.

Installation costs often account for 40–50% of the total price.

5. Underlayment and Insulation

Metal roofing typically requires a high-temperature synthetic underlayment to manage moisture and noise. If your home also needs improved insulation or radiant barriers, these upgrades will add to your total but also boost energy efficiency and comfort.

Is a Metal Roof Worth the Higher Cost?

Many Canton homeowners ask whether the higher upfront cost of a metal roof is justified. The answer often lies in long-term value and performance.

Long Lifespan

Metal roofs last 2 to 3 times longer than asphalt shingles. Many come with 30–50 year warranties.

Energy Efficiency

According to the U.S. Department of Energy, metal roofing reflects solar radiant heat, which can reduce cooling costs by up to 25%.

Low Maintenance

Unlike shingles, which can crack or shed granules, metal panels resist wind, hail, mildew, and fire—reducing repair and replacement costs over time.

Eco-Friendly

Most metal roofing contains recycled materials and is 100% recyclable at the end of its life, contributing to sustainability efforts and green building initiatives.

Additional Costs to Consider

While metal roofs come with many benefits, it’s helpful to be aware of additional expenses:

  • Tear-Off of Old Roofing: $1,000–$2,500 depending on size and layers

  • Permits & Inspections: $150–$500 depending on local regulations

  • Snow Guards or Ice Barriers: Important in snowy areas like Canton

  • Soundproofing or Deck Reinforcement: Optional, but sometimes recommended for comfort and safety

Maintenance Costs for Metal Roofing

Metal roofs require minimal maintenance compared to shingles. Still, annual inspections are recommended to check fasteners, sealants, and flashing. A professional inspection typically costs between $150–$300 but helps extend your roof’s lifespan and catch small issues early.

You should also:

  • Clean gutters regularly

  • Remove debris from roof valleys

  • Ensure snow or ice is not accumulating dangerously in winter

With proper maintenance, your metal roof could easily last 50+ years.

Metal Roof vs. Asphalt Shingles: Cost Comparison Over Time

Feature

Asphalt Shingles

Metal Roof

Lifespan

15–25 years

40–70 years

Upfront Cost

$3.50–$6.00/sq. ft.

$5.50–$12.00/sq. ft.

Energy Efficiency

Moderate

High (reflects solar heat)

Maintenance

Higher

Lower

Resale Value Impact

Good

Excellent

Warranty Options

15–30 years

30–50+ years

While asphalt roofs are more affordable initially, metal roofs often offer better value over time, especially for homeowners planning to stay in their homes long-term or those interested in eco-friendly upgrades.
